Did I read here recently that I can product change one of my chase freedoms to a CSR even though I recently got a new CSP?
I’m booking a hotel through the portal and would save about $280 just on this one trip if I had the CSR.
Yes, you can product change your Chase Freedom to a CSR while simultaneously holding a CSP. This isn't a loophole- so you aren't doing anything "against the rules." Sapphire rules don't allow you to earn a BONUS on both the CSP and CSR within 48 months, but there's nothing wrong with product changing.

For others interested, the MDD is how one can achieve a bonus on both the CSP and CSR.

I can go direct PHL-FRA on Lutfthansa but on the way home they want an 8 hour layover in EWR which is a 2.5 hour drive from my house so that is out. I may try the 1 hour layover in CLT on AA. Last time I was in CLT was for a domestic layover so I have to look up if I would have to switch terminals.

Just remember you'll have to clear immigration in CLT upon landing from FRA and even with Global Entry (if you have it) that seems like a mighty short layover since boarding is usually 30 min prior to takeoff and IIRC AA is pretty keen to depart on time. I'm risk adverse and not sure I'd chance it but if they sell it, then I guess it's over the legal connection time.
